Second person dies in stage collapse
A second person has died following the collapse of a stage being constructed for a Madonna concert in France.
Charles Prow, a 23-year-old from Headingley in Leeds, died overnight at a hospital in Marseilles.
Technicians had been setting up the stage at the city's Velodrome stadium when the partially-built roof fell in on Thursday, bringing down a crane.
Madonna said she was 'devastated' by the news. Her concert, planned for Sunday, has been cancelled.
Charles Criscenzo, a 53-year-old French worker, was killed outright in the accident, which took place at around 1715 (1615 BST).
Eight other people were seriously hurt, including an American who was hospitalised in a life-threatening condition.
More than 30 people suffered minor injuries and shock, according to authorities.
The 60,000-seater Velodrome is France's second-biggest sports arena and home to the Olympique de Marseille football club.
Fire-fighters said the accident occurred when the roof of the stage became unbalanced as it was being lifted by four cranes, toppling one of them.
About 50 people from a range of nationalities were working to set up the structure, city sports official Richard Miron said.
The roof 'started shaking and collapsing' gradually, said Marseilles city councillor Maurice Di Nocera. 'Since it did not collapse right away that allowed several people to get out,' he said.
Madonna, who is performing on her Sticky and Sweet tour, was in Udine, Italy, when she was told of the incident.
'I am devastated to have just received this tragic news,' she said in a statement released by Live Nation, the organisers of the concert.
'My prayers go out to those who were injured and their families, along with my deepest sympathy to all those affected by this heartbreaking news.'
Mr Prow's family have contacted the BBC, saying he was 'a much-loved son, grandson, brother, uncle and friend'.
'Charles was a happy-go-lucky guy with a big personality and he will be deeply missed,' said a representative.

Madonna stage collapse police launch manslaughter

inquiryOfficers examining 60 tonnes of collapsed girders and cables hope to interview more than 50 witnesses

http://static.guim.co.uk/sys-images/...-that--001.jpg


Police in Marseille have launched a manslaughter investigation into the collapse of a stage roof this week that killed two people during preparations for a Madonna concert.

Detectives hope to interview more than 50 witnesses to the accident, in which two technicians – a 23-year-old Briton and a 53-year-old Frenchmen – died and up to 30 others were injured.

Doctors at Marseille's main hospital were unable to save Charles Prow, from Headingley, Leeds, medical sources said. One other casualty remained in intensive care.

Police are conducting a detailed examination of the 60 tonnes of collapsed girders and cables that is all that remains of the "giant Meccano" stage set that was being prepared at the south French city's 60,000-seat Vélodrome stadium, which is home to Olympique Marseille.

Video footage being studied by investigators apparently shows the roof "oscillating" before part of it collapsed on to a crane, which then fell on the main stage. The roof, which was two-thirds complete, "started shaking and collapsing" gradually, a Marseille city councillor, Maurice Di Nocera, told French radio.

The concert was cancelled and Madonna, who was performing in Udine, Italy, when she heard the news, issued a statement saying she was "devastated". The concert was part of a second European leg of Madonna's Sticky and Sweet tour aimed, the star's website said, at "hitting the cities she didn't get a chance to in 2008".

Madonna concluded the South American leg of her world tour in Sao Paulo, Brazil, in December. Even before this summer's European dates, Sticky and Sweet had become the biggest-selling tour by a solo artist – taking £193m worldwide by the end of last year, according to the music trade publication Pollstar.

The tour has sparked controversy in Poland because its Warsaw stage is on 15 August, the Catholic holiday celebrating the heavenly assumption of the Virgin Mary. Poland's ombudsman, Janusz Kochanowski, has asked city officials to explain why Madonna would be allowed to perform on a date "bound to provoke and offend".

Exclusive Reports: Latest report from the location of Madonna's new video

Last wednesday M-Tribe reported first about the shooting at the Metropol club in Milano and today our long time community member Lombo1983 reports for Tribe from the location of the Celebrate video at Metropol:
"Last night I was at the Metropol, every fan came up with a madonna look. The fashion stylist there was looking at the fans' various outfits, looks and memorabilia and in case they were not what they wanted they helped with extra clothes and stuff they had ready there.

They used a total of 25 fans and among the look that were chosed there were Like a virgin, Cowgirl, Gheisha, Hung up, 1987 look, DWT look and more. Reportedly director Jonas Akerlund stood there on the set for the all time and apparently Madonna tried on several wigs. Madonna did some rehearsals for the video on friday but her bits were filmed yesterday. They apparently filmed for 8 hours just the same part of the song over and over and they never played the full song. These footage will be edited with the parts filmed last week at the Gold restaurant and the fans.

The fans taking part to the video first danced to the new dancey song all together, then they were filmed separately while dancing on his/her own in front a white screen.

The final editing will probably happen in New York and security there revealed that Milan was the location chosen since the start since Dolce & Gabbana offered their Metropol space reportedly for free."

Madonna To Work On Top Secret Project

Madonna is planning to work with artist Marilyn Minter on a new project.

The Queen of Pop is a fan of the controversial artist's work and displays one of her photos (a pair of pink lips) on the stage set-up for her current Sticky + Sweet tour.

Now Minter has revealed Madonna has approached her for a collaboration, to which she has agreed - but Marilyn isn't sure what the singer has in mind.

Minter told the New York Daily News: "She wants to come by my studio, so I guess I will find out then. Maybe she wants me to photograph her, or to work on a video."

GREATEST HITS INFO NOW LEAKED!!!

Quote:

For Immediate Release (Burbank, California) - Madonna, who has racked up a record 37 top 10 hits as well as seven No. 1 albums (including her last four) on the Billboard Pop Charts, has given her fans yet another opportunity to “celebrate” her musical achievements. Today, Warner Bros. Records officially confirmed the September 28th release in the U.S. (September 29 outside U.S.) of “CELEBRATION” – the ultimate compilation of Madonna songs. The songs on “Celebration” have all been remastered and selected by Madonna and her fans. They cover the expanse of the Material Girl’s extraordinary career of hits including “Everybody,” “Express Yourself,” “Vogue” and “4 Minutes.” “Celebration” will be available in a two-CD set as well as a single CD. There will also be a “Celebration” DVD released simultaneously which includes the video visionary’s best videos including several that have never before been available on DVD.

“Celebration,” the CD will also include two new songs that were recently recorded in New York City. The first single, also titled, “Celebration,” co-produced by Madonna and Paul Oakenfold, will be released August 3rd. A video for the single, which will be included on the “Celebration” DVD was just filmed in Milan, Italy and was directed by long time Madonna collaborator Jonas (“Ray of Light”) Akerlund. Several dance club remixes of “Celebration” are already headed to the clubs. The song will also be available on CD and vinyl maxi. Radio will receive the “Celebration” single on August 3rd.

The cover for “Celebration” was created by street pop artist “Mr. Brainwash” who is best known for “throwing modern cultural icons into a blender and turning it up to eleven.” (A copy of the cover image of the “Celebration” CDs and DVDs is attached)

Madonna, a multi Grammy award winning singer, writer and producer has had over 12 No. 1 singles and has a record-smashing 39 No. 1 singles on Billboard’s Hot Dance Club Songs Chart – by far the most of any artist in the over 30 year history of the list.

Mr. Brainwash, the creator of Madonna's "Celebration" album cover, started his career in France as a documentary film maker to become later a popular street artist. He currently resides in L.A and where he is a well known graffiti artist.
His "Celebration" cover reprises the classic Madonna shot by Jean-Baptiste Mondino that premiered on "Bazaar" magazine in 1990 blended with another iconic 1987 portrait by Alberto Tolot.

Madonna 'grieved with stage hand's family'

http://images.digitalspy.co.uk/08/18...x_762929al.jpg

The father of a man who died when a stage collapsed during construction of a Madonna concert has revealed that the singer cried with his family.

British technician Charles Prow, 23, was killed after a partially-built roof subsided at the Velodrome Stadium in Marseilles last Thursday, causing a supporting crane to topple over.

Speaking to The Mirror, dad Chris Prow said: "Madonna just said to [his mother Faith], 'I'm so sorry for your loss'. She gave her flowers and a spiritual health book. Madonna said how much she had been affected by the accident, and got very emotional."

He went on to say that Faith had met the singer at a hotel after receiving a letter saying that Madonna wanted to see her in person. Chris added that the family did not hold the star responsible for their son's death.

One other man was killed in the incident, while eight other people were seriously injured. Prosecutors in France have since opened a manslaughter investigation into the accident.
